How I/O request is processed in EVA and MSA
Can any one please explain me how I/O request is processed by EVA and MSA(1500/1000) storage controllers.I need step by step process.

Re: How I/O request is processed in EVA and MSA
Reads/Writes always via one controller either A or B
active/active
writes always via both controllers to both caches (mirror ports)
good reads via the so called managing controller - negotiated by MPIO ALB
bad reads viac the so called proxy controller - via the mirror port and the managing controller
